#efa149 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#efa149 is composed of 93.7% red, 63.1%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.6% magenta, 69.5%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 31.8 degrees, a saturation of 83.8% and a lightness of 61.2%. #efa149 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ff92 with #df4300.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

Shades and Tints of #efa149

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100901 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#efa149

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a39c95 is the less saturated color, while #fea23a is the most saturated one.
